Hi Brian: This server is an older one: DODS server core software: DODS DAP++/3.4.8 Server version: jg-dods/3.4.3It doesnt appear to conform to the opendap spec, since it wont accept ?Level_0 query, although its possible that the netcdf java library isnt doing the right thing with Sequences. Hi All,I'm trying to access JGOFS bottle data using NetCDF-Java. The JGOFS data is being served via OPeNDAP at the URL: http://usjgofs.whoi.edu/dods-bin/nph-dods/jgofs/merged_objects/US_JGOFS/Equatorial_Pacific/bottle_eqpac. The DDL can be viewed at http://usjgofs.whoi.edu/dods-bin/nph-dods/jgofs/merged_objects/US_JGOFS/Equatorial_Pacific/bottle_eqpacHere's the issue:---- I'm actually using the NetCDF-Java inside of Matlab (see http://code.google.com/p/nctoolbox/). The versions of the Java jars are:netcdf-4.0 opendap-2.1---- Here's the steps I'm taking in Matlab. (It looks like Java pseudo-code) : url = 'http://usjgofs.whoi.edu/dods-bin/nph-dods/jgofs/merged_objects/US_JGOFS/Equatorial_Pacific/bottle_eqpac'netcdf = ucar.nc2.dataset.NetcdfDataset.openDataset(url); vars = netcdf.getVariables(); v = vars.get(0); foram = v.findVariable('foram'); data = foram.read(); When I make the call to 'read()' the following Exception is thrown:opendap.dap.DAP2Exception: "Could not open bottle_eqpac(Level_0): l_jdbopen, &x Bad Name: Level_0: "at opendap.dap.DConnect2.openConnection(DConnect2.java:233) at opendap.dap.DConnect2.getData(DConnect2.java:699) at opendap.dap.DConnect2.getData(DConnect2.java:979)at ucar.nc2.dods.DODSNetcdfFile.readDataDDSfromServer(DODSNetcdfFile.java:1125)at ucar.nc2.dods.DODSNetcdfFile.readData(DODSNetcdfFile.java:1289) at ucar.nc2.Variable._read(Variable.java:927) at ucar.nc2.Variable.read(Variable.java:791) at ucar.nc2.Variable._read(Variable.java:914) at ucar.nc2.Variable.read(Variable.java:791) at ucar.nc2.dataset.VariableDS._read(VariableDS.java:469) at ucar.nc2.Variable.read(Variable.java:791) ??? Java exception occurred:java.io.IOException: "Could not open bottle_eqpac(Level_0): l_jdbopen, &x Bad Name:Level_0: " at ucar.nc2.dods.DODSNetcdfFile.readData(DODSNetcdfFile.java:1296) at ucar.nc2.Variable._read(Variable.java:927) at ucar.nc2.Variable.read(Variable.java:791) at ucar.nc2.Variable._read(Variable.java:914) at ucar.nc2.Variable.read(Variable.java:791) at ucar.nc2.dataset.VariableDS._read(VariableDS.java:469) at ucar.nc2.Variable.read(Variable.java:791)Note: This happens both inside of Matlab and in just plain Java. Am I accessing the JGOFS data structure correctly?
